BT Financial Group's George Lytas has moved to CommInsure to assume the new role of head of annuities for its superannuation and investment business.

General manager for the department Greg Ballard said Lytas is starting the role at a juncture where there the demand for guaranteed retirement income products such as annuities is rising.

"George brings a wealth of knowledge in the development of retirement income solutions for the Australian market. We are delighted to appoint George to help drive growth of our annuities business," he said.

Lytas has 20 years of experience, including as national manager for general insurance at BT Financial Group for three and a half years.   

Prior to that he was at ING Direct for eight years where was in many roles including head of product development, where he led a team that developed retirement income and investment solutions for the Australian market.

He was also senior product manager at AMP, and held senior roles at Colonial and the Royal SunAlliance Group.
